Google’s newest Arts & Lifestyle initiative takes us by means of electronic music—its background, its innovators, and of system, its devices. And “Google AR Synth” instrument specially made for the new Songs, Makers, and Machines undertaking puts you at the rear of some of the most revolutionary synths and drum machines, with just plenty of assistance to maintain every little thing in tune.
“Google AR Synth” consists of 5 traditional devices, like the ARP Odyssey, the Roland CR-78, and the floppy disc-centered Fairlight CMI. You can location as many devices as you like on a digital soundstage, with the selection to adjust notes, tempo, tone, and samples in a a person-bar loop. Utilizing “Google AR Synth” on a laptop computer or desktop sets you in black and white place, but opening the internet application on your cellular phone unlocks AR support, so you can put the instruments in your room applying your phone’s digicam.

Google sourced its instrument samples from the Swiss Museum for Digital Songs Instruments, a single of the numerous areas you can see in a digital tour via Google Arts & Tradition.
